Transaction 52b68143113f28526f2b0066d8d8131277a539c56d4884128236c16fff54b93e
1 Input
1 Output
-
52b68143113f28526f2b0066d8d8131277a539c56d4884128236c16fff54b93e:0
- value
- 22000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2f63fc959300231f7ec40b1964947119246fa6aecb9cb5d8aeff511833c1b2bf
- address
- bc1p9a3le9vnqq337lkypvvkf9r3ryjxlf4wewwttk9wlag3sv7pk2ls0euus9